For the Future of Hip Hop, All That Glitters is Not Gold Teeth

Stanley Crouch has a point that's worth listening to. It's time for a change. In his article, "The Futue of Hip Hop, All That Glitters is Not Gold Teeth," he makes the point that a lot of the lyrics and images now associated with Hip Hop have, indeed, gone way overboard. I don't know about you, but frankly, I am tired of liquor, cars, hoes, blunts, bling, sex, guns, and cash being the whole story - or even part of the story - however looped around. Unfortunately, grime and smut sell. There are a lot of grimy people out here - male and female. Like, let me show you or tell you all the nasty shit I know and see how many of you I can bring down to that level. So what do you think?
